    Membrane systems and their different variants (e.g. P Colonies with transferable programs) can be used to model various processes if we are satisfied with simple rules manipulating the elements of a set of objects. However, these systems were designed more for computational purposes, so we may encounter problems when solving non-numerical problems. Reaction systems, on the other hand, come with the concept of reactants and inhibitors, which we can also use in simulating (typically dynamic) processes. In this paper, we compare these two concepts and propose a new type of system: IR Colonies, which are inspired by both of these concepts. The IR Colonies are designed to be mainly applicable for modeling communication in the Internet of Things networks. In the paper, the reader will find both a proposed definition of IR Colonies and an example of a network model with several IoT devices.
